Witryna3.11.4 Karyotyping. Karyotyping is the process of pairing and ordering all the chromosomes of an organism, which gives a genome wide idea of any individual’s chromosomes. Standardized staining methods are employed in the preparation of karyotypes, which helps in revealing the structural features of each chromosome. Witryna8 mar 2024 · The procedure known as Karyotyping is an investigation undertaken by a Clinical Geneticist to examine the chromosomes of an individual patient. The purpose of examining the chromosomes is to determine whether any structural issues or abnormalities exist within them.
